How did Susan B Anthony impact society ?
g100num [7]

Answer:

<u><em>Susan B. Anthony was a pioneer crusader for women's suffrage in the United States. She was president (1892–1900) of the National Woman Suffrage Association. Her work helped pave the way for the Nineteenth Amendment (1920) to the Constitution, giving women the right to vote.</em></u>

When did Abraham Lincoln propose the 13th amendment that abolished slavery? ​
Scrat [10]
1865, Jan.
United States House of Representatives passed the joint resolution proposing a thirteenth constitutional amendment abolishing slavery, which the Senate had passed in April 1864.
